网站PHP技术如何对接数据库?
一、了解数据库类型与选择合适的PHP扩展
在开始对接之前,要明确所使用的数据库类型,如MySQL、PostgreSQL或SQLite等。不同的数据库类型可能需要使用不同的PHP扩展。,对于MySQL数据库,常用的PHP扩展有mysqli和PDO。选择合适的扩展不仅能提高开发效率,还能确保代码的可维护性和安全性。
二、配置数据库连接参数
配置数据库连接参数是对接过程中的基础步骤。通常需要在PHP脚本中设置数据库的主机地址、端口号、用户名、密码以及数据库名称。这些参数应存储在配置文件中,以便于管理和修改。通过使用配置文件,不仅可以提高代码的安全性,还能方便地进行环境切换(如开发、测试和生产环境)。
三、建立数据库连接
使用PHP扩展提供的函数来建立与数据库的连接。以mysqli为例,可以通过mysqli_connect()函数来实现。在连接过程中,需要注意处理可能出现的错误,如连接失败或权限不足等问题。通过捕获和处理这些异常,可以提高代码的健壮性。
四、执行SQL查询与操作
一旦建立了数据库连接,就可以开始执行SQL查询和操作。可以使用PHP扩展提供的函数来执行SELECT、INSERT、UPDATE和DELETE等操作。在执行查询时,应注意使用预处理语句(Prepared Statements)来防止SQL注入攻击。预处理语句不仅能提高查询效率,还能增强代码的安全性。
五、关闭数据库连接
在完成所有数据库操作后,应及时关闭数据库连接。这不仅可以释放系统资源,还能避免潜在的安全隐患。大多数PHP扩展都提供了关闭连接的方法,如mysqli_close()。确保在脚本的一步调用这些方法,以养成良好的编程习惯。
通过以上步骤,开发者可以有效地实现PHP技术与数据库的对接。掌握这些方法不仅能提高开发效率,还能确保网站的安全性和稳定性。希望本文能为您提供有价值的参考。更新时间:2025-06-20 04:19:05
上一篇:栏目网站设计需要注意什么? 栏目页面如何提升转化率?